Para remover / desinstalar e limpar todas as configurações da forma correta:
sudo apt remove mysql-server --purge
ou sudo apt purge --auto-remove mysql-server
Em seguida, reinstale: sudo apt install mysql-server
Eu instalei o MySQL 5.7 a partir do terminal e de alguma forma esqueci a senha que defini segundos atrás. Eu estou tentando recuperá-lo agora, no entanto, quando eu executo:
sudo mysql_safe --skip-grant-tables --skip-networking &"
Recebo a seguinte mensagem de erro:
2018-06-01T06:33:00.696985Z mysqld_safe Logging to '/var/log/mysql/error.log'
2018-06-01T06:33:00.699129Z mysqld_safe Directory '/var/run/mysqld' for UNIX socket file don't exists
Alguma idéia sobre como recuperar minha senha?
É possível remover a configuração e reinstalar o servidor MySQL do zero, definindo uma nova senha?
Se assim for, como eu iria sobre isso?
Para remover / desinstalar e limpar todas as configurações da forma correta:
sudo apt remove mysql-server --purge
ou sudo apt purge --auto-remove mysql-server
Em seguida, reinstale: sudo apt install mysql-server
Obrigado! Eu tentei nos dois sentidos e depois de executar a instalação novamente continua pedindo a senha de root em vez de me pedir para definir um novo. Aqui está a saída do terminal insira a descrição da imagem aqui